PROGRAM ACCOMPLISHMENTS
FORM 990, PART III, LINE 4A
- IN THE FIRST PHASE OF THE MULTI-YEAR RAINBOW PROGRAM, HALF THE SKY CO-TRAINED WITH CHINA CENTER FOR CHILDREN'S WELFARE AND ADOPTION (CCCWA) 763 CAREGIVERS AND ADMINISTRATORS IN THE PROVINCIAL TRAINING BASES IN SIX PROVINCES: JIANGSU, HENAN, HUNAN, SHA'ANXI, HUBEI AND GUANGDONG. - CONTINUED ONGOING OPERATION OF PROGRAMS IN WELFARE INSTITUTIONS AND AIDS-AFFECTED VILLAGES IN HENAN PROVINCE. - CONTINUED ONGOING MANAGEMENT OF THE CRITICAL CARE PROGRAM FOR MEDICALLY VULNERABLE ORPHANS AT THE CHINA CARE HOME, BEIJING - BENEFITTING OVER 250 IN 2011, AND 566 IN OPERATIONS FROM MAY 2009 TO END 2011. - SECURED AGREEMENT TO ESTABLISH RAINBOW PROGRAM PROJECT OFFICES IN EACH PROVINCIAL TRAINING BASE, TO BE ESTABLISHED AS THE TRAINING ROLLS OUT TO THAT PROVINCE. - BY THE END OF 2011, HTS OPERATED 51 CENTERS IN 24 PROVINCES AND MUNICIPALITIES. - TOTAL CHILDREN SERVED BY YEAR-END: APPROXIMATELY 11,000 - ESTIMATED NUMBER OF CHILDREN WHO HAVE BENEFITED FROM THE PROGRAMS: 60,000 - PUBLISHED 2 BILINGUAL YOUTH SERVICES NEWSLETTERS, ANNUAL REPORT, 3 EMAIL CHINA CARE PROGRESS REPORT NEWSLETTERS, 3 CHINESE DIRECTORS' NEWSLETTERS, NUMEROUS EMAIL NEWSLETTERS TO CONSTITUENTS, AND THOUSANDS OF INDIVIDUAL PROGRESS REPORTS FOR EVERY CHILD IN THE ORGANIZATION'S PROGRAMS - CONTINUED WORK ON DEVELOPING AND FINALIZING FOR PUBLICATION A NATIONAL TRAINING CURRICULUM FOR HTS PROGRAMS, AS WELL AS DEVELOPING IN CO-OPERATION WITH THE GOVERNMENT THE CURRICULUM MATERIALS FOR THE RAINBOW PROGRAM. - CO-HOSTED WITH CCCWA 2 NATIONAL DIRECTORS' WORKSHOPS IN ZHENGZHOU, HENAN PROVINCE (MAY) AND GUILIN, GUANGXI (OCTOBER) ATTENDED IN EACH CASE BY OVER 100 INSTITUTIONAL PARTNERS. THE THEME OF THE FIRST WORKSHOP WAS THE INTEGRATION OF HTS PROGRAMS INTO THE DAILY LIFE OF THE INSTITUTIONS; THE THEME OF THE SECOND WAS TRAINING AND DEVELOPMENT.
Review of form 990 by governing body
Form 990, Part VI, Section B, Line 11b
AN EXTERNAL ACCOUNTING FIRM AND HALF THE SKY FOUNDATION STAFF WORK TOGETHER TO GATHER THE REQUIRED TAX INFORMATION NECESSARY TO COMPLETE THE RETURN. THE ACCOUNTING FIRM PREPARES THE INITIAL DRAFT AND REVIEWS THE INITIAL DRAFT WITH THE FINANCE TEAM. RECOMMENDED CHANGES ARE REFLECTED IN THE FINAL RETURN AND THEN SENT TO THE BOARD OF DIRECTORS BEFORE THE FINAL 990 IS FILED WITH THE IRS.
Conflict of interest policy
Form 990, Part VI, Section B, Line 12c
ALL NEW AND EXISTING BOARD MEMBERS AND OFFICERS ARE REQUIRED TO UPDATE THE CONFLICT OF INTEREST FORM ANNUALLY. THESE ARE REVIEWED BY THE BOARD AS WELL AS THE E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R. IF A CONFLICT OF INTEREST EXISTS, THE DIRECTOR SHALL LEAVE THE MEETING WHILE THE TRANSACTION IS DISCUSSED AND SHALL NOT VOTE ON THE ISSUE.
Process used to establish compensation of top management official
Form 990, Part VI, Section B, Line 15a
THE BOARD MEMBERS CONDUCT AN ANNUAL REVIEW BY INTERVIEWING BOARD AND DIRECT REPORTS. THE BASIS FOR SALARY COMPENSATION IS DERIVED FROM TWO SOURCES: CENTER FOR NONPROFIT MANAGEMENT COMPENSATION & BENEFITS SURVEY AND CHARITY NAVIGATOR OR CHRONICLE OF PHILANTHROPY SURVEYS. AFTER THE BOARD VOTES ON THE RECOMMENDATIONS MADE BY THE COMPENSATION COMMITTEE, THE COMMITTEE MEETS WITH THE EMPLOYEE, SHARES THE REVIEW AND CONVEYS THE BOARD-APPROVED COMPENSATION FOR THE UPCOMING YEAR.
COMPENSATION PROCESS FOR OTHER OFFICERS
FORM 990, PART VI, LINE 15B
THE COMPENSATION FOR HTS ASIA OFFICERS AND EMPLOYEES ARE PROPOSED BY THE E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R AND THE CFO BASED ON THE SALARY INFORMATION PROVIDED BY LOCAL RECRUITMENT AGENCIES AND APPROVED BY THE BOARD OF HTS US. SINCE THE E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R IS INVOLVED IN THE DETERMINATION OF COMPENSATION FOR THE OTHER OFFICERS, WE HAVE HAD TO CHECK THIS QUESTION 'NO' SINCE THE E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R WOULD NOT BE CONSIDERED INDEPENDENT.
